need 940 sunroof or drive cable 900

You good folks are my last resort ... I found a broken drive cable in my 940 sunroof, and nobody on line has one in stock, #3526114 Right.

If I could find a complete used sunroof, I'd go that route.

Anybody have either the cable or a sunroof kicking around?

Hope you're well. The part (#3526114) seems still to be available. A Volvo dealer should be able to order one, from Volvo USA. Worst case, the part will have to be shipped from Sweden (or elsewhere). MSRP is about $58 at a U.S. Volvo dealer.

This is a "dealer only" part, i.e., the usual suppliers (e.g., www.fcpgroton.com) won't inventory it. Thus, you might want to contact Tasca Volvo (www.tascavolvo.com) or Borton Volvo (www.bortonvolvo.com). Both are reliable suppliers.

I'd replace both drive cables. If one failed, the other is likely to do so. Accessing these items isn't easy, so it is best to do both.

Tasca says the #114 cable is available, at $50+, but the #113 cable is not. Shipping would be 5-7 weeks from Sweden.

I did manage to find a used Volvo parts house in Atlanta, Voluparts, who disassembles sunroofs and has both cables for $25 each. I'm going to try that.

I may replace both cables, or at least the #114 right-hand cable, depending on how difficult the project is.

Hope you're well. At $25 for both cables, I'd buy a spare set.

Rust and friction (rubbing) are the enemies of stranded steel cables. To extend these cables' service life, I'd coat each cable with the grease used on garage door parts.

This grease - usually sold in aerosol cans - comes out as a spray (and so penetrates) and then congeals. Grease that penetrates prevents rust. This grease also reduces wear. The grease coats the steel strands - that comprise each cable - reducing direct steel-to-steel contact and so wear.

To clarify Spook's comments, the sunroof drive cable is a "worm gear" cable, steel wrapped in a spiral pattern around a central core.

In my case, the central steel cable had pulled out of the end fitting that connects the cable to the sunroof gate (tilt). The outside spiral wrapping was intact, but dry.
I greased the new cable liberally with high-temp grease as I slid it into the side rail and guide tube.
